Устанавливаем python-пакеты с помощью pip

pip — это система управления пакетами, которая используется для установки и управления программными пакетами, написанными на Python.
Установка pip
Прежде чем с помощью pip устанавливать python-пакеты, нужно сначала установить сам pip.
Python 3.4+
Начиная с Python версии 3.4, pip поставляется вместе с интерпретатором python.
Python
- Загрузить get-pip.py (обязательно сохранив с расширением .py).
- Запустить этот файл (могут потребоваться права администратора).
Есть ещё один способ (для Windows). Возможно, он является более предпочтительным:
- Установить setuptools http://www.lfd.uci.edu/~gohlke/pythonlibs/#setuptools
- Установить pip http://www.lfd.uci.edu/~gohlke/pythonlibs/#pip
Начало работы
Попробуем с помощью pip установить какой-нибудь пакет, например, numpy:
sudo pip3 install numpy
pip3 install numpy
Может не сработать, написав: «python» не является внутренней или внешней командой, исполняемой программой или пакетным файлом (такого, скорее всего, не должно быть при установке pip вторым способом, но проверить не на чем).
Тогда нужно обращаться напрямую:
Либо добавлять папку C:\Python34\Tools\Scripts\ в PATH вручную (самому проверить не на чем, можете посмотреть на stackoverflow. У кого получится — напишите в комментарии).
Что ещё умеет делать pip
Пробежимся по основным командам pip:
pip help — помощь по доступным командам.
pip install package_name — установка пакета(ов).
pip uninstall package_name — удаление пакета(ов).
pip list — список установленных пакетов.
pip show package_name — показывает информацию об установленном пакете.
pip search — поиск пакетов по имени.
pip —proxy user:passwd@proxy.server:port — использование с прокси.
pip install -U — обновление пакета(ов).
pip install —force-reinstall — при обновлении, переустановить пакет, даже если он последней версии.
Для вставки кода на Python в комментарий заключайте его в теги
- Модуль csv - чтение и запись CSV файлов
- Создаём сайт на Django, используя хорошие практики. Часть 1: создаём проект
- Онлайн-обучение Python: сравнение популярных программ
- Книги о Python
- GUI (графический интерфейс пользователя)
- Курсы Python
- Модули
- Новости мира Python
- NumPy
- Обработка данных
- Основы программирования
- Примеры программ
- Типы данных в Python
- Видео
- Python для Web
- Работа для Python-программистов
- Сделай свой вклад в развитие сайта!
- Самоучитель Python
- Карта сайта
- Отзывы на книги по Python
- Реклама на сайте
Установка Python и pip #
При установке необходимо поставить галочку возле опции «Добавить путь к Python в переменную PATH », иначе вы не сможете получить доступ к необходимым командам в терминале. При детальной установке необходимо поставить галочку возле опции pip , иначе вам придётся качать pip отдельно.
MacOS #
- Для установки Python будем использовать пакетный менеджер Homebrew. Пропишите в командной строке brew install python . Поскольку по умолчанию на MacOS ставится Xcode, который включает в себя Python 2.7, для запуска Python 3 в командной строке используйте команду python3 , а так же для установки пакетов нужно будет писать не просто pip , а pip3 .
- Если у вас уже есть Python 3, но нет pip , то введите в командной строке следующие команды:
cur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py python3 get-pip.py
Linux #
Чтобы установить Python и pip в Linux, достаточно выполнить соответствующие команды для вашего дистрибутива.
Установка pip в Debian/Ubuntu #
sudo apt update sudo apt install python sudo apt install python3-pip
Установка pip на CentOS и RHEL #
sudo yum update sudo yum install epel-release sudo yum install python sudo yum install python-pip
Установка pip на Fedora #
sudo dnf update sudo dnf install python3
Установка pip на Arch Linux #
sudo pacman -Syu sudo pacman -S python sudo pacman -S python-pip
Установка pip на openSUSE #
sudo zypper refresh sudo zypper install python sudo zypper install python3-pip
Как установить PIP для Управления Пакетами Python В Windows
PIP — это система управления пакетами, используемая для установки и управления программными пакетами, написанными на Python. Это означает “preferred installer program” или “Pip Installs Packages”.
PIP для Python — это утилита для управления установкой пакетов PyPI из командной строки.
Если вы используете более старую версию Python в Windows, то вам может потребоваться установить PIP. Вы можете легко установить PIP в Windows, для этого загрузите установочный пакет, открыв командную строку и запустив программу установки.
В этой статье будет подробно показано, как установить PIP в Windows, проверить его версию, обновить и настроить.
Примечание: Последние версии Python поставляются с предустановленным PIP, но более старые версии требуют установки вручную. Следующее руководство предназначено для версии 3.4 и выше. Если вы используете более старую версию Python, вы можете обновить Python через веб-сайт Python.
Требование к установки Python PIP в Windows
- Компьютер под управлением Windows или Windows server
- Доступ к окну командной строки
Перед началом работы: Проверьте, установлен ли PIP уже
PIP автоматически устанавливается с Python 2.7.9+ и Python 3.4+ и поставляется с виртуальными средами virtualenv и pyvenv.
Перед установкой PIP в Windows проверьте, не установлен ли PIP уже.
1. Запустите окно командной строки:
- Нажмите клавишу Windows + X.
- Нажмите кнопку Выполнить.
- Введите cmd.exe и нажми «Ввод».
Возможно вам будет интересно: Как защитить информацию на компьютере
Либо просто введите cmd в строке поиска Windows и щелкните значок “Командная строка”.
2. Введите следующую команду в командной строке:
Если PIP отвечает, то PIP установлен. В противном случае появится сообщение об ошибке, в котором говорится, что программа не найдена.

Установка PIP В Windows
Выполните действия, описанные ниже, чтобы установить PIP в Windows.
Шаг 1: Загрузите PIP get-pip.py
Перед установкой PIP скачайте get-pip.py файл.
1. Запустите командную строку, если она еще не открыта. Для этого откройте строку поиска Windows, введите cmd и нажмите на значок командной строки.
2. Далее выполните следующую команду, чтобы загрузить get-pip.py файл:
cur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py

Шаг 2: Установка PIP в Windows
Чтобы установить PIP, введите следующую команду в cmd:

Если файл не найден, дважды проверьте путь к папке, в которой вы сохранили файл. Вы можете просмотреть содержимое текущего каталога, используя следующую команду:
Команда dir возвращает полный список содержимого каталога.
Шаг 3: Проверка установки pip в ОС Windows
После установки PIP вы можете проверить, была ли установка успешной, для этого введите следующую команду:
Если PIP был установлен, программа запускается, и вы должны увидеть расположение пакета программного обеспечения и список команд, с которыми вы можете работать pip .

Если вы получите сообщение об ошибке, тогда повторите процесс установки.
Шаг 4. Добавьте PiP в переменную среду Windows PATH
Чтобы запустить PIP из любого места, вам необходимо добавить его в переменные среды Windows, чтобы избежать ошибки «not on PATH«. Для этого выполните действия, описанные ниже:

- Откройте компьютер и нажмите свойства
- Далее дополнительные параметры системы
- Нажмите на кнопку Переменные среды и дважды щелкните переменную Пути в Системных переменных.
- Затем выберите Создать и добавьте каталог, в который вы установили PIP.
- Нажмите кнопку ОК, чтобы сохранить изменения.
Шаг 5: Настройка
В Windows файл конфигурации PIP является %HOME%\pip\pip.ini.
Существует также устаревший файл конфигурации для каждого пользователя. Файл находится по адресу %APPDATA%\pip\pip.ini .
Вы можете задать пользовательский путь для этого файла конфигурации с помощью переменной среды PIP_CONFIG_FILE .
Обновление PIP для Python в Windows
Время от времени выпускаются новые версии PIP. Эти версии могут улучшить функциональность или быть обязательными в целях безопасности.
Чтобы проверить текущую версию PIP, запустите:

Чтобы обновить PIP в Windows, введите следующую команду в командной строке:
python -m pip install --upgrade pip
Эта команда удаляет старую версию PIP, а затем устанавливает самую последнюю версию PIP.
Понизить версию PIP
Понижение версии может потребоваться, если новая версия PIP начнет работать нестабильно. Чтобы понизить PIP до предыдущей версии, укажите нужную версию.
Чтобы понизить версию PIP, используйте синтаксис:
python -m pip install pip==version_number
Например, чтобы перейти на версию 18.1, вы должны ввести команду:
Теперь вы должны увидеть версию PIP, которую вы указали.
Поздравляю, вы установили PIP для Python в Windows. Ознакомьтесь с другими нашими руководствами, чтобы узнать, как установить PIP в других операционных системах:
- Установка PIP в Ubuntu
- ИСПРАВЛЕНИЕ “E: INVALID OPERATION PYTHON3-PIP” В KALI LINUX
Теперь, когда у вас запущен и запущен PIP, вы готовы управлять своими пакетами Python.
NumPy — это библиотека для языка программирования Python, добавляющая поддержку больших многомерных массивов и матриц. Ознакомьтесь с нашим руководством и узнайте, как установить NumPy с помощью PIP.
pip не является внешней или внутренней командой / не распознано как имя командлета, функции, файла сценария или выполняемой программы
Когда я пытаюсь установить модуль, выдает: "pip не является внешней или внутренней командой, исполняемой программой или пакетным файлом. Я прокладывал полный путь. Установщик пакетов, вроде, не нужно устанавливать отдельно. Windows 7.
Отслеживать
13.7k 12 12 золотых знаков 43 43 серебряных знака 75 75 бронзовых знаков
задан 6 фев 2017 в 19:14
Даниил Василевский Даниил Василевский
141 1 1 золотой знак 1 1 серебряный знак 4 4 бронзовых знака
Да просто инсталлятор не прописал путь в PATH
6 фев 2017 в 19:43
5 ответов 5
Сортировка: Сброс на вариант по умолчанию
Вам нужно установить путь к pip в переменные окружения, это можно сделать при установке python выбрав пункт Add Python to PATH.
Если вы уже установили, но забыли выбрать этот пункт, можно добавить путь вручную:
Панель управления -> Система -> Дополнительные параметры системы -> Переменные среды
Вы увидите 2 окошка, Переменные среды пользователя для и Системные переменные , вам нужно первое, нажимаем на переменную Path -> Изменить , далее вы увидите поле Значение переменной , в конец поставьте разделитель ; и добавьте путь к директории где находится pip (например, C:\Python\Scripts , путь к директории Python может отличаться).
Отслеживать
48.6k 17 17 золотых знаков 56 56 серебряных знаков 100 100 бронзовых знаков
ответ дан 13 мая 2018 в 7:31
Pavel Durmanov Pavel Durmanov
5,746 3 3 золотых знака 22 22 серебряных знака 44 44 бронзовых знака
При установке Python вам необходимо установить pip и, возможно, отметить Add Python to PATH.
Отслеживать
ответ дан 7 фев 2017 в 13:51
user234958 user234958
python3 -m pip -V
Если вернёт версию, то устанавливать можно так
python3 -m pip install pip
Рекомендую использовать совместно с Virtual Environment
Отслеживать
ответ дан 21 янв 2020 в 15:08
4,962 1 1 золотой знак 9 9 серебряных знаков 27 27 бронзовых знаков
Это сообщение означает, что система не может найти файл pip, который вы пытаетесь запустить. Возможно, у вас не установлен Python или переменная среды PATH не содержит директорию, в которой находится установленный Python.
Чтобы установить Python, перейдите на сайт https://www.python.org/ и скачайте и установите самую последнюю версию. Убедитесь, что установка добавит Python в переменную среды PATH.
После установки Python вы должны быть в состоянии запускать pip, чтобы устанавливать модули. Например, чтобы установить модуль requests, выполните следующую команду:
pip install requests
Если у вас возникают проблемы с установкой модулей с помощью pip, попробуйте выполнить команду pip install -U pip, чтобы обновить версию pip до самой последней.